Robinson Payne llcA Law Firm Focusing on Business, Banking and Estate Planning
Illinois Intestacy Law(755 ILCS 5/2-1):
• No Spouse or Kids = Divided Evenly Between Parents, Brothers and Sisters
• One Parent Already Dead (Predeceased) = Other Parent Gets Double Share
• Sibling Predeceased Leaving Kids = Nieces and Nephews Divide the Share their Parent would have gotten (per stirpes)
• Children inherit at age 18, Guardian appointed prior to that

Robinson Payne llcA Law Firm Focusing on Business, Banking and Estate Planning
Illinois Intestacy Law(755 ILCS 5/2-1):
• If no Heirs Found = real estate goes (escheats) to the county in which it is located, personal property physically located in Illinois escheats to the county in which the decedent lived, or the county in which it is located if the decedent did not live in IL. All other personal property escheats to the state.

Robinson Payne llcA Law Firm Focusing on Business, Banking and Estate Planning
Last Will and Testament – Disadvantages (vs. Trust):
• Must go through Probate process - additional time and expense
• No Confidentiality - Will is filed upon death and becomes a public record
• Does nothing to minimize estate tax payable by heirs
